Core Viewpoint - The article emphasizes the growing demand for stealth materials in modern air combat, highlighting their critical role in enhancing the performance of advanced military aircraft and the significant market potential for these materials [2][3][4]. New Demand - The emergence of stealth air combat has created a fundamental need for stealth materials, as stealth aircraft like the F-22 have proven to be decisive in combat scenarios [18][19]. - Stealth capabilities allow aircraft to choose optimal engagement and disengagement strategies, significantly reducing the opponent's chances of effective counteraction [19]. New Market - The demand for stealth materials is expected to grow rapidly in both the pre-installation market, driven by advanced aircraft like the fourth-generation fighters, and the post-installation market, where maintenance and updates are necessary to sustain performance [3][4]. - Lockheed Martin reported that 50% of the maintenance costs for the F-22 are attributed to stealth coatings, indicating a robust aftermarket for stealth materials [3]. New Logic - The investment logic for stealth materials is categorized into four phases: 1. Short-term: Increased demand for stealth materials as new aircraft are deployed. 2. Mid-term: Significant potential for performance enhancement and increased penetration rates of stealth materials. 3. Long-term: Expansion of stealth requirements into structural components, creating new growth opportunities. 4. Aftermarket: Large order volumes leading to economies of scale, driving sustained industry growth [4][7]. New Pattern - The stealth materials industry exhibits high barriers to entry, including military qualification, first-mover advantages, and research and development challenges [5]. - U.S. military stealth materials are primarily developed in-house or in collaboration with laboratories, establishing a competitive edge that is difficult for latecomers, such as Chinese manufacturers, to overcome [5]. Product Analysis - Stealth materials are categorized into three main types: infrared stealth, radar-absorbing materials, and metamaterials, each addressing different detection technologies [46]. - The primary focus of stealth material research is on reducing radar cross-section (RCS) and infrared emissions, which are critical for enhancing stealth capabilities [37][46]. Industry Dynamics - The stealth materials market is characterized by a growing need for advanced military capabilities amid tightening international security situations, leading to increased defense spending [3][4]. - The article outlines the historical development of stealth technology, indicating a shift from initial concepts during World War II to the current advanced stealth systems [30][31].
